Learning outcomes

The course intends to offer practical and theoretical knowledge to people who - within the scope of sports activities - they will want to do: the teacher, the coach, the social animator and the trainer. The aim of the course is to provide an effective and useful teaching methodology according to the contribution of all human sciences in the following areas: professional ethics, learning and motivation.

Program

The concept of the human person according to the human sciences
The concept of human and sports movement: cognitive, emotional and bodily
Sport and the human person: well-being and competitive spirit
Teaching the sports movement: education, pedagogy and didactics
The science of sports teaching: history and theory
The school and sports tools of teaching
The pedagogy of K. Lorenz: for a comparative didactics applied to motor science (by Dr. Donato Sarcinella)
The figures of the sports world who teach, train and animate through teaching
Clinical teaching methodology
Didactics and its relationship with ethics
Sport and ethics
Interactive frontal lessons, testimonials, film viewing, exercises.


Lecture notes and texts: G. Bergamaschi, D. Sarcinella, The teaching of coaching in motor science, QuiEdit, Verona 2017, with Preface by Ferdinando De Giorgi. G. Bergamaschi, Instructions for use to become better, QuiEdit, Verona 2020



Examination Methods

Oral; for the attendants it is possible to take the exam in writing.
